在网络安全日益复杂的今天,自动修复安全漏洞成为了提高防御效率的关键。机器人技术在网络安全领域的应用,正逐渐成为智能防御的新篇章。本文将深入探讨机器人如何自动修复安全漏洞,以及这一技术的未来发展。
1. 背景与挑战
1.1 安全漏洞的威胁
随着网络攻击手段的不断升级,安全漏洞成为威胁网络安全的重要因素。这些漏洞可能存在于软件、硬件、系统配置或用户操作中,一旦被利用,可能导致数据泄露、系统崩溃等严重后果。
1.2 传统修复方法的局限性
传统的安全漏洞修复方法主要依靠人工进行,存在以下局限性:
- 效率低:人工检测和修复漏洞需要大量时间和精力。
- 成本高:需要投入大量人力进行安全防护。
- 响应速度慢:难以在漏洞被利用前及时发现并修复。
2. 机器人自动修复安全漏洞的原理
2.1 人工智能与机器学习
机器人自动修复安全漏洞的核心在于人工智能(AI)和机器学习(ML)技术。通过大量的安全数据训练,AI模型可以学会识别漏洞、分析攻击路径,并自动生成修复方案。
2.2 漏洞识别与分类
机器人首先需要对安全数据进行收集和分析,识别出潜在的安全漏洞。然后,根据漏洞的类型和影响程度进行分类,以便针对性地进行修复。
2.3 修复方案生成与验证
机器人根据漏洞类型和攻击路径,生成相应的修复方案。修复方案可能包括代码修复、系统配置调整、安全策略优化等。机器人会对修复方案进行验证,确保其有效性和安全性。
3. 案例分析
3.1 自动修复Web应用漏洞
某公司利用机器人技术自动修复了其Web应用的SQL注入漏洞。机器人通过分析Web应用代码和日志,识别出SQL注入漏洞,并自动生成修复方案,包括参数化查询和输入验证。经过验证,修复方案成功阻止了SQL注入攻击。
3.2 自动修复操作系统漏洞
某企业采用机器人技术自动修复了其操作系统的漏洞。机器人通过分析系统日志和安全数据,识别出操作系统漏洞,并自动生成修复方案,包括更新系统补丁和配置安全策略。修复方案经过验证,有效提高了操作系统的安全性。
4. 未来发展趋势
4.1 人工智能与大数据的融合
随着大数据技术的不断发展,机器人将能够获取更多安全数据,进一步提高漏洞识别和修复的准确性。
4.2 智能防御体系的构建
未来,机器人技术将与防火墙、入侵检测系统等安全设备深度融合,构建起智能防御体系,实现网络安全自动化的全面升级。
4.3 跨领域协同创新
机器人技术在网络安全领域的应用将推动跨领域协同创新,为网络安全发展注入新的活力。
5. 结论
机器人自动修复安全漏洞是智能防御的新篇章。随着人工智能和机器学习技术的不断发展,机器人将在网络安全领域发挥越来越重要的作用。通过提高漏洞修复效率,机器人技术将为网络安全保障提供有力支撑,助力构建更加安全的网络环境。